Speaking at the meeting, Vietnam's Minister of Science and Technology, Nguyen Manh Hung, welcomed China's Vice Minister of Industry and Information Technology, Zhang Yunming, to the 6th ASEAN Digital Ministers' Meeting hosted by Vietnam, and affirmed the strategic role of digital cooperation in the context of ASEAN entering a period of strong transformation.
According to the Minister, ASEAN has agreed to shift telecommunications from traditional infrastructure to digital infrastructure, considering AI as a new type of infrastructure that forms the foundation for long-term development. Along with this, they are promoting the transition from e-government to digital government, developing a digital innovation ecosystem, and gradually forming a digital economy .
Emphasizing that digital infrastructure is a strategic infrastructure for the region, Minister Nguyen Manh Hung highly appreciated China's coordination and support for ASEAN in the field of telecommunications and digital technology .
During the meeting, Deputy Minister Truong Van Minh expressed his appreciation for Minister Nguyen Manh Hung's consistent interest in bilateral cooperation. The Deputy Minister stated that in the digital age, "networks are the foundation, applications are key, resources are the core, AI is the driving force, and security is the guarantee." He expressed confidence that, under Minister Nguyen Manh Hung's leadership, Vietnam's science and technology, innovation, and digital transformation will be strongly promoted, thereby contributing to national socio-economic development.
Deputy Minister Truong Van Minh also emphasized that cooperation between the two Ministries is based on a solid foundation of high-level relations between the two Parties and States. The Memorandum of Cooperation in the field of information and communication technology and digital transformation with the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ology of China (signed in December 2023) has become an important framework for the two sides to implement substantive cooperation activities in the next five years. China is ready to work with Vietnam to deepen cooperation in key areas such as digital connectivity, digital economy, AI; industrial infrastructure and information industry.
Sharing his experience in development, the Deputy Minister stated that after seven years of deployment, 5G has become a crucial platform for promoting new-style industrialization and modernization in China. Currently, 5G is widely applied in almost all sectors of the national economy, from smart ports and smart transportation to smart factories and mines. China is ready to support Vietnam in promoting 5G application in the direction of "building networks to serve development," while also supporting Chinese enterprises in bringing advanced technology, products, and experience to Vietnam.

On the Vietnamese side, Minister Nguyen Manh Hung stated that 5G coverage has now reached approximately 90% of the population, but its application is still not commensurate with its potential. Based on this, Vietnam hopes to strengthen cooperation with China in developing 5G application models, sharing next-generation telecommunications services, and expanding deeper cooperation in the field of AI.
The Minister expressed interest in China's approach to AI development and governance, and proposed strengthening cooperation in training and developing digital human resources through the China-ASEAN Digital Academy Initiative. In addition, the Minister requested the Chinese Ministry of Industry and Information Technology to support connecting Chinese technology companies with Vietnamese network operators, and to coordinate the deployment of 5G "application zones" in key industrial parks, high-tech zones, smart ports, and exemplary digital economy models.
The two sides also exchanged views on multilateral cooperation, in which Vietnam affirmed its continued support for Chinese candidates in international organizations such as the International Telecommunication Union (ITU) and the Asia-Pacific Telecommunication Organization (APT), as well as its active participation in conferences hosted by China in the future.

At the end of the working session, the leaders of both sides agreed to maintain regular exchanges, accelerate the implementation of signed agreements, and soon realize concrete cooperation results that bring practical benefits to both Vietnam and China, while contributing to building an inclusive and sustainable regional digital ecosystem.
